Transaction 516801bf753bae34a1bc5c5b34449e50518b3e99e09f0c09dd6e8b4bdd3078a7
1 Input
1 Outputs
- 516801bf753bae34a1bc5c5b34449e50518b3e99e09f0c09dd6e8b4bdd3078a7:0
value 35756377
address 13Rf98dBz64DGFQMugFVFDLfQbrsGqeAtW